In the game Driver and Biker, players go through several tests at driving school to get their driver’s licence. When they reach the required score, they can ride motorbikes and drive cars, trucks, and buses around a small town.
The game highlights the importance of paying attention in traffic to avoid accidents and fines, reinforcing the concepts of safe driving and citizenship values.
The game Driver and Biker is part of the Lifesaver Club, created by Edu and his friends, to work towards accident prevention and environmental care. This is how the Lifesaver Club arose, inviting players to become true agents of good.
On the home screen, players must select a level. The first time they play, all levels will be locked. When they tap the chosen level, a screen with instructions for the proposed challenge will appear.

The game Driver and Biker aims to show students that being a good driver or motorcyclist goes beyond manual skills: it also requires theoretical knowledge, such as understanding and following traffic laws and signals.
The game promotes safe habits and behaviours in traffic, motivating students to turn knowledge into action through observation, experiences, and everyday situations.
Although it is an individual game, it can also be used in group activities by promoting debates about the quiz questions and challenging students to come up with strategies for driving the vehicle safely.
